在本文中,我们将讨论Python中的变量类型转换方法。 1. int()函数 int()函数用于将一个字符串或浮点数转换为整数。如果字符串或浮点数不能转换为整数,则会引发ValueError异常。 例如,我们可以使用int()函数将字符串“123”转换为整数: ``` num_str = "123" num_int = int(num_str) print(num_int) ```...
转换数据类型比较通用的方法可以用astype进行转换。 pandas中有种非常便利的方法to_numeric()可以将其它数据类型转换为数值类型。 pandas.to_numeric(arg, errors='raise', downcast=None) arg:被转换的变量,格式可以是list,tuple,...
比如下面的实例里,a的类型可以根据数据来确认,但是我们没办法预测变量d的类型: 如果临时想要查看一个变量存储的数据类型,可以使用type(变量的名字),来查看变量存储的数据类型: 二、标识符和关键字 计算机编程语言中,标识符是用户编程时使用的名字,用于给变量、常量、函数、语句块等命名,以建立起名称与使用之间的关系。
print(id(变量名或变量)) c.注意事项 Python中的变量不需要声明。每个变量在使用前都必须赋值,变量赋值以后该变量才会被创建。 Python中变量就是变量,它没有类型,我们所说的"类型"是变量所指的内存中对象的类型。 等号(=)用来给变量赋值。 等号(=)运算符左边是一个变量名,等号(=)运算符右边是存储在变量中的...
一、变量类型转换 1.规则 int(x)将x转为整型 float(x)将x转为浮点型 2.上家伙 # 将字符串转为整型a ="123"int(a)print(a)# 将字符串转为浮点型b ="1.23"int(b)print(b)>>>123>>>1.23 __EOF__
1.创建一个Python文件,定义一个整型变量num_int初始值为10,将整型变量转换为float类型后,在控制台打印输出,编写如下代码:2.运行代码查看运行结果 3.创建一个Python文件,定义一个浮点型变量num_float初始值为10.8,利用int()函数将变量num_float转换为整数,舍去小数部分,并将结果在控制台打印输出,编写如下...
我们通过使用负数的例子就可以知道了: >>> int(-3.1) -3 >>> int(-3.9) -3 所以,int函数得到的结果仅仅是浮点数数据的整数部分! 最后对知识点简单总结和要求: 1、掌握什么是变量。 2、掌握三种变量类型。 3、掌握变量类型之前的转换方法。
Python编程中可以使用内置函数来实现变量类型间的相互转换,比如int()函数可以将字符串转换为整型,float(...
在Python中,你可以使用一些内置的函数来进行变量类型的转换。以下是一些常用的类型转换函数: int():将一个数值或字符串转换为整数类型。 num_str = "10" num_int = int(num_str) print(num_int) # 输出:10 float():将一个数值或字符串转换为浮点数类型。
方法一:pd.factorize 方法二:df.col.astype('category').cat.codes 方法三:sklean.LabelEncoder 三者的对比和区别: cat.codes和factorize的区别 cat.codes和factorize都可以将分类变量转换为数字编码,但它们的输出方式不同。cat.codes函数会返回一个Series对象,其中每个唯一的类别都会被赋予一个唯一的整数编码。而factor...